Teton Springs Lodge Prop Management

Photos

20 Headwater Dr
Victor, ID 83455

Teton Springs Resort is a tranquil retreat nestled in the heart of Victor, ID, offering a range of accommodations and amenities for guests seeking relaxation and outdoor adventures.

With stunning views of the Teton Mountains, the resort provides a peaceful setting for visitors to unwind and enjoy activities such as golf, fly fishing, and spa treatments.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esIdahoVictorTeton Springs Lodge Prop Management

Partial Data by Infogroup (c) 2025. All rights reserved.